Blackpool's housing stock is a mixed bag of Victorian terraces, inter-war semis, and post-war estates, and most of them come with relatively compact outdoor spaces that still benefit from proper landscaping. The Fylde Coast's sandy, free-draining soil suits certain planting styles well, but it also means lawns can dry out quickly in summer and struggle with coastal winds that batter gardens on the west side of town. If you're closer to the seafront in areas like South Shore or Bispham, salt-tolerant planting and robust boundary treatments are worth discussing with any landscaper you're considering. Gardens in Marton and Mereside tend to be larger and more sheltered, which opens up options for formal lawn design, block paving driveways, or more ambitious garden room builds. Many Blackpool landscapers also offer ongoing maintenance packages alongside one-off design and installation work, which makes sense given how quickly Fylde Coast gardens can become overgrown during a wet spring.

Before committing to any landscaper, get at least three written quotes and make sure each one breaks down labour and materials separately rather than giving you a single lump sum. Ask specifically whether the business holds public liability insurance and request to see the certificate, not just a verbal confirmation. If you're having hard landscaping done, such as paving, decking, or a new driveway, ask whether any groundwork or drainage changes will require planning permission or need to comply with permitted development rules. Check whether the landscaper uses a written contract that covers start date, payment schedule, and what happens if materials costs change. If a company has done similar work in your postcode area, a quick chat with a previous customer is worth more than any review screenshot.

How much does a landscaper cost in Blackpool?
Basic garden clearance and turfing typically costs £15-25 per square metre. Patio installation ranges from £40-80 per square metre depending on materials - concrete slabs start around £40, whilst natural stone can reach £80-100. Complete garden makeovers for typical Blackpool terraced house gardens (30-50 square metres) usually cost £2,000-6,000 including plants, hard landscaping, and labour. Prices vary significantly based on access, existing ground conditions, and material choices. Always get two or three detailed quotes to compare fairly.
What plants work in Blackpool's coastal climate?
Salt-tolerant plants perform much better here than inland varieties. Tamarisk, sea buckthorn, and escallonia handle the coastal winds well for screening. For flowers, consider thrift, lavender, and ornamental grasses like miscanthus. Many landscapers recommend raised beds with improved soil for vegetables, as the local sandy soil drains too quickly for most crops. Avoid delicate plants like hostas or ferns in exposed positions - they'll struggle with the salt spray and wind.
Do I need planning permission for landscaping work?
Most garden landscaping doesn't require planning permission, but there are exceptions. Permitted development rights allow patios, paths, and garden buildings under 2.5 metres high (4 metres for dual-pitched roofs). However, if you're raising ground levels near boundaries or installing significant drainage, check with Blackpool Council first. Conservation areas have stricter rules. Your landscaper should know the local requirements, but the final responsibility lies with you as the property owner.
How long does a typical garden project take?
Simple jobs like turfing or basic planting can be completed in 1-3 days. Patio installation typically takes 3-5 days for an average-sized area, depending on groundwork needed. Complete garden redesigns often take 1-2 weeks, though this can extend if drainage improvements are needed - common in Blackpool's sandy soil areas. Weather delays are frequent here, especially during winter months. Good landscapers will give you a realistic timeline and keep you updated about any delays.
What's the ideal time of year for landscaping in Blackpool?
Spring (March-May) and early autumn (September-October) are optimal for most work. Planting during these periods gives plants time to establish before winter or summer stress. Hard landscaping like patios can be done year-round unless ground conditions are frozen, though winter delays are common due to weather. Avoid major turfing in summer - the combination of sandy soil and coastal winds makes new lawns struggle in hot weather. Book early for spring slots as these are always in high demand.
How can I verify a landscaper's credentials and reliability?
Check their Google reviews for patterns - look for mentions of punctuality, site cleanliness, and staying within quoted prices. Ask for recent local references and actually contact them. Verify public liability insurance (minimum £2 million) and check they're registered for VAT if charging it. Search Companies House for their trading history. Professional memberships of the Association of Professional Landscapers or similar bodies indicate commitment to standards. Always get written quotes and avoid paying large sums upfront.
